WebJul 19, 2016 · This corroded flue needs a liner and insulation UL Listed Chimney Liners Only UL Listed stainless liners with the necessary insulation will meet the zero clearance to combustibles requirements for UL1777. There are two types of insulation available to provide this safety for your home. The first is the blanket wrap. WebThe flue gases are corrosive and can stain and damage clay tiles requiring more frequent cleaning and repairs. Since stainless steel liners are naturally resistant to corrosion and rust, the fumes exit the flue without damaging the liner, making it easier to clean and maintain. More Energy Efficient

WebApr 5, 2024 · Stainless steel flue liner materials cost $20 to $90 per linear foot. Steel liners are compatible with all fireplace and stove fuel types. Steel liners last 15 to 20 years if well-maintained.
